The Crane Control Room Key is a key item in Crimson Desert. It unlocks the crane control room door at Karin Quarry during the House Roberts faction quest.
The Engraved Key is a key item in Crimson Desert. It is a transformed version of the Shabby Wooden Key, bearing a mysterious engraved symbol, used to access a hidden chamber in Hernand Castle.
The Shabby Wooden Key is a key item in Crimson Desert. It is a gift from a beggar near the Hernand Tavern that later transforms into the Engraved Key.
The Key is a consumable key item in Crimson Desert used to unlock standard doors throughout Pywel. Keys are generic and interchangeable, consumed automatically when approaching a locked door.
The Old Shabby Key is a key item in Crimson Desert given by a beggar during the Mysterious Man quest. Despite its worn appearance, it opens something valuable.
The Key to the Spire of the Stars is a key item in Crimson Desert. Given by Grundir, it is required to enter the Spire of the Stars on the hill behind Scholastone Institute.
The Prison Key is a Key Item in Crimson Desert used to unlock prison cells holding criminals of lesser importance.
The Grace Manor Iron Door Key is a key item in Crimson Desert found on a desk in Glenbright Manor during the Traces in the Manor quest.
